How to Make a BMW F36 Gran Coupe Look Aggressive?

A BMW F36 Gran Coupe becomes more aggressive through a coordinated approach to aero upgrades and stance refinement. Adding a carbon fiber front splitter, side skirts, and rear diffuser creates a unified visual flow, while lowering the ride height and optimizing wheel fitment enhances presence. High-quality 2x2 twill carbon with UV-resistant coating ensures lasting gloss, durability, and a cohesive performance-inspired appearance.

What Are the Most Effective Aero Mods for the F36?

The most impactful aero upgrades for the F36 include a front splitter, side skirts, and rear diffuser, all working together to reshape airflow and visual proportions. A splitter extends the front profile and lowers the nose visually, while a diffuser adds rear aggression and depth. How Do Side Skirts Complete the 360° Carbon Look?

Side skirts act as the visual connector between the front splitter and rear diffuser, creating a continuous carbon fiber line along the vehicle’s body. Without them, aero elements appear disconnected. VB Carbon engineers align skirt contours with splitter edges and diffuser exits, allowing the weave pattern to flow uninterrupted. This creates a full 360-degree design language that lowers the perceived center of gravity and enhances the car’s length, making the F36 look wider and more planted.

Why Does UV Protection Matter for Carbon Fiber?

UV protection is essential to prevent carbon fiber from fading, yellowing, or losing its gloss over time. Exposure to intense sunlight, especially in climates like Nevada, accelerates degradation if coatings are insufficient. How Does Stance Improve the Aggressive Look?

Stance enhances aggressiveness by reducing wheel gap, widening the visual footprint, and lowering the car’s center of gravity. A properly lowered F36 complements aero upgrades by aligning body lines closer to the ground. Wider wheels and optimized offsets create a flush fitment that amplifies the vehicle’s presence.

Setup Element Visual Impact Functional Benefit
Lowered Suspension Reduced wheel gap Improved handling balance
Wider Wheels Increased visual width Enhanced grip
Wheel Spacers Flush alignment with fenders Better cornering stability

How Can You Achieve a Wide Look Without Widebody Kits?

A wide appearance can be achieved through strategic use of aero components and wheel fitment without altering the vehicle’s body structure. Side skirts with slight outward extensions, combined with a sculpted rear diffuser, increase perceived width. Aggressive wheel offsets and tire profiles further enhance this effect.

Component Visual Effect
Side Skirts Extends lower body outward
Rear Diffuser Adds rear-end depth
Wheel Offset Pushes wheels closer to fenders
Tire Width Creates fuller stance

Does Aero Actually Improve Performance or Just Looks?

Aero upgrades can improve performance by managing airflow, reducing lift, and enhancing stability, especially at higher speeds. While many F36 owners prioritize aesthetics, functional benefits still exist. A well-designed splitter helps stabilize the front end, and a diffuser optimizes rear airflow. FAQs

What is the first upgrade recommended for F36 styling?
A front splitter is typically the best starting point, as it immediately enhances the car’s front-end presence and sets the foundation for additional aero upgrades.

Do side skirts make a noticeable difference?
Yes, they visually connect the front and rear aero elements, creating a complete and cohesive design that significantly improves overall appearance.

Will carbon fiber parts last in hot climates?
High-quality carbon fiber with proper UV-resistant coating, such as those from VB Carbon, is designed to withstand intense sunlight without fading or yellowing.

Is lowering necessary for an aggressive look?
Lowering is not mandatory, but it greatly enhances the effectiveness of aero upgrades by reducing wheel gap and improving visual balance.

Can I achieve a wide stance without a widebody kit?
Yes, using wider wheels, proper offsets, and well-designed aero components can create a broader appearance without permanent body modifications.
